Identify degree of hazard
- Categories 1, 2, 3, 4, 5
- Lower number = greater hazard
- I.e. 3 is more hazardous than 5
Sub-Categories
- A, B, C
- The higher the letter is in the alphabet (closer to the beginning of the alphabet) is higher the hazard is, i.e. B is more hazardous than C.
